摘 要:根据煤矿企业隐患排查治理工作实际需要,利用信息技术和网络技术,提出了煤矿事故隐患管理与预警方法,设计了与之配套的、基于B/S模式的应用软件——煤矿事故隐患管理与预警系统,并在事故隐患预警与动态监控的基础上开展隐患管理工作。该系统具有隐患整改管理、隐患预警、隐患动态监控、隐患信息检索分析等主要功能,有助于科学、规范地开展隐患排查治理的常规工作,也可实时、准确地监测控制重大事故隐患及隐患整改状况,促进和保障煤矿事故隐患排查治理效果。According to the actual needs of the coal mine enterprise in hidden danger investigation and management work,the hidden danger management and early warning method for coal mine accidents were proposed by using the information and network technology,an application software based on B / S mode- the hidden danger management and early warning system for coal mine accidents was designed,and on the basis of the early warning and dynamic monitoring of the accident hidden dangers,the hidden danger management work was carried out. The main function of this system included the rectification and management,earning warning,dynamic monitoring,information retrieval and analysis of the hidden dangers,so it can not only help to carry out the routine governance work of hidden dangers,but also to real- timely and accurately monitor the major accident hidden dangers and their rectification status and to promote and guarantee the investigation and governance effect of the accident hidden dangers in coal mines.
